"What did you have for dinner?"

Niamh stared at Jonathan's message for ten minutes, unable to bring herself to reply.

Any drowsiness she felt had vanished. She tossed and turned for hours before finally drifting off to sleep.

The Thomas Group's annual gala was held at the Grand Riverview's 57th-floor revolving restaurant.

Employees were allowed to bring one or two guests.

Niamh brought only Lana. Given Julian's current situation, it just didn't seem right for him to show up at The Thomas Group.

It was Lana's first time wearing an evening gown, and she was so giddy with excitement she nearly twisted her ankle.

Niamh had picked out the dress herself—a sleek, off-the-shoulder style that suited Lana perfectly.

Both Lana's dress and Niamh's own midnight-blue velvet gown were from ZM.

Every year, by tradition, the gala would open with Jonathan taking the stage and delivering a speech as the host introduced him.

But this year, the format was different.

Instead, Jonathan invited a woman to join him for the opening dance.

And of course, he chose Marina. Tonight, Marina's makeup and gown were even more dazzling than usual. Her dress, though also pink, radiated an undeniable confidence that outshone everyone else in the room.

With the whole company watching, Jonathan took Marina's hand, slipped his arm around her waist, and they glided across the floor.

"How is this any different from making things official?" Jayne's voice floated from behind Niamh.

"Official? What do you mean—" Lana had started to turn around, but Niamh quickly hushed her.

The last thing she wanted was for anyone at work to know about her and Jonathan.

True, the divorce had been dragged out by Jonathan for far too long, but as long as they remained separated for two years, she'd still have the right to file for divorce.

Since it was just a matter of time, there was no reason to let more people know—especially at the office.

Otherwise, Jonathan would just assume she was deliberately outing their relationship, claiming she wanted a divorce when she secretly hoped for a reconciliation.

On the dance floor, Jonathan and Marina twirled gracefully.
